Correlation and unification of computational and experimental findings

This part of the project will require statistical evaluation of the correspondence between available in vivo toxicity data, in vitro occurrence of biochemical markers, and in silico-modeled thermodynamic parameters for given chemicals. We will use proven statistical approaches such as including nearest-neighbor clustering, partition analysis and multivariate modeling to explore the descriptors in pairwise and multivariate fashions. These analyses will establish whether the anticipated and mechanistically rationalized relationships exist between the in silico parameters and the in vitro / in vivo data.
